moverzp的博客

Inner Peace & Keep Moving

moverzp的博客目录

moverzp的博客目录标签: 工具 一、机器视觉学习笔记这个部分主要分享博主学习OpenCV和机器视觉的笔记,包括但不限于基本的OpenCV操作,图像处理的算法和一些典型例程。机器视觉学习笔记(1)——OpenCV配置机器视觉学习笔记(2)——基于DirectShow的多摄像头视频采集机器视觉学...

2016-01-29 17:01:51

阅读数 1594

评论数 0

Kaggle练习赛Titanic手札

Kaggle练习赛Titanic手札标签: Kaggle参考资料:https://www.kaggle.com/omarelgabry/titanic/a-journey-through-titanic/comments一、Titanic练习赛介绍kaggle上面的比赛有若干种,分别是Featur...

2016-10-21 18:19:48

阅读数 1679

评论数 3

基于Python查看SVD压缩图片的效果

基于Python查看SVD压缩图片的效果标签: Python 机器学习机器学习中常用的降维方法是主成分分析(PCA),而主成分分析常用奇异值分解(SVD)。那么SVD的效果到底如何呢?SVD常用来进行图像的压缩,我们就来实验一下。用到的包: PIL numpy 实验载入一张彩色图片,分别对其RGB...

2016-08-25 21:44:59

阅读数 3222

评论数 2

K均值聚类算法(K-Means)

K均值聚类算法(K-Means)标签: Python 机器学习1.K均值算法简介K均值聚类算法首先是聚类算法。 聚类是一种无监督的学习,将相似的对象归到同一个簇中。聚类与分类的最大不同在于分类的目标事先已知,而聚类则不知道。 K均值聚类算法是发现给定数据集k个簇的算法。如下图所示,如果设定的聚...

2016-07-10 17:37:52

阅读数 45472

评论数 10

基于物品的协同过滤算法:理论说明,代码实现及应用

基于物品的协同过滤算法:理论说明,代码实现及应用标签: 爬虫 Python主要参考资料: 项亮. 推荐系统实践[M]. 北京:人民邮电出版社, 2012.转载请注明出处:sss0.一些碎碎念从4月中旬开始,被导师赶到北京的郊区搬砖去了,根本就没有时间学习看书,这个时候才知道之前的生活是多么的幸福...

2016-07-04 20:25:50

阅读数 19395

评论数 0

爬取了豆瓣11W+网页,获取了5W+有效书籍信息

爬取了豆瓣11W+网页,获取了5W+有效书籍信息标签:爬虫 Python之前写了一篇博文:利用爬虫获取豆瓣上可能喜欢的书籍,这篇博文中的爬虫可以以给定的url为原点,慢慢的向外扩散爬取书籍信息,可以获取到自己可能喜欢的书籍,但是有一个大缺点,就是只能提供一个初始url,即以一本书为基础进行推荐,而...

2016-05-15 16:24:20

阅读数 6822

评论数 9

手把手实现AdaBoost算法

手把手实现AdaBoost算法标签: 机器学习 Python主要参考资料: Peter HARRINGTON.机器学习实战[M].李锐,李鹏,曲亚东,王斌译.北京:人民邮电出版社, 2013. 李航.统计学习方法[M].北京:清华大学出版社, 2012 1.AdaBoost算法简介当一个分类器正确...

2016-04-24 20:03:58

阅读数 4884

评论数 0

使用不同的SVM对iris数据集进行分类并绘出结果

使用不同的SVM对iris数据集进行分类并绘出结果标签: 机器学习 Python译文之前的碎碎念SVM学习了也有一段时间了,公式基本都推导了一遍,明显感觉SVM的推导过程比之前学习的机器学习模型的推导过程都复杂,所以不打算自己实现SVM了,既然使用了Python,那就调用一下第三方的SVM包吧。经...

2016-04-11 16:03:54

阅读数 17706

评论数 2

利用爬虫获取豆瓣上可能喜欢的书籍

利用爬虫获取豆瓣上可能喜欢的书籍标签: 爬虫 Python1.目标博主比较喜欢看书,购物车里面会放许多书,然后等打折的时候开个大招。然而会遇到一个问题,就是不知道什么书是好书,不知道一本书到底好不好,所以常常会去豆瓣读书看看有什么好书推荐,不过这样效率比较低。最近学习了爬虫的基础知识,有点手痒,故...

2016-04-05 21:39:01

阅读数 7729

评论数 0

朴素贝叶斯(naive bayes)

朴素贝叶斯(naive bayes)标签: Python 机器学习主要参考资料:《机器学习实战》《统计学习方法》1.朴素贝叶斯分类原理朴素贝叶斯法是基于贝叶斯定理和特征条件独立假设(称为朴素的原因)的分类方法。先看看维基百科中贝叶斯定理的描述: 贝叶斯定理(维基百科) 通常,事件A在事件...

2016-04-01 15:39:13

阅读数 2366

评论数 0

手把手生成决策树(dicision tree)

手把手生成决策树(dicision tree)标签: Python 机器学习1.什么是决策树决策树是一种基本的分类和回归方法,本文主要讲解用于分类的决策树。决策树就是根据相关的条件进行分类的一种树形结构,比如某高端约会网站针对女客户约会对象见面的安排过程就是一个决策树: 根据给定的数据集创建一个...

2016-03-25 14:25:45

阅读数 8410

评论数 1

k近邻法(k-nearest neighbor)

k近邻法(k-nearest neighbor)标签: 机器学习 Python1.什么是k近邻法k近邻法是一种基本的多分类和回归的算法,常常简称为kNN。kNN在李航的《统计学习方法》中的描述如下: 给定一个训练数据集,对新的输入实例,在数据集中找到与该实例最近邻的k个实例,这k个实例的多数属...

2016-03-19 16:07:37

阅读数 2682

评论数 0

梯度下降法(Gradient descent)

梯度下降法(Gradient descent)标签: 机器学习1.梯度下降法有什么用梯度下降法用来求函数的极小值,且是一种迭代算法,由于计算效率高,在机器学习中常常使用。梯度下降法经常求凸函数(convex function)的极小值,因为凸函数只有一个极小值,使用梯度下降法求得的极小值就是最小值...

2016-03-13 15:09:51

阅读数 11419

评论数 5

小白学算法4.1——二叉查找树

小白学算法4.1——二叉查找树标签: 小白学算法1.什么是二叉查找树(Binary Search Tree)二叉查找树是一种特殊的二叉树,相对于普通的二叉树,其有如下特点: 若任意结点的左子树不空,则左子树上所有结点的值均小于它的根结点的值 任意结点的右子树不空,则右子树上所有结点的...

2016-03-12 15:39:49

阅读数 605

评论数 0

牛刀小试(03)——透镜扫描(网易2016研发工程师编程题)

牛刀小试(03)——透镜扫描(网易2016研发工程师编程题)标签: 牛刀小试1.题目描述在N*M的草地上,提莫种了K个蘑菇,蘑菇爆炸的威力极大,兰博不想贸然去闯,而且蘑菇是隐形的.只有一种叫做扫描透镜的物品可以扫描出隐形的蘑菇,于是他回了一趟战争学院,买了2个扫描透镜,一个扫描透镜可以扫描出(3*...

2016-03-05 22:00:52

阅读数 2150

评论数 7

小白学算法3.3——三向字符串快速排序

小白学算法3.3——三向字符串快速排序标签: 小白学算法1.三向字符串快速排序算法MSD对包含大量重复键的字符串进行排序时,效率十分低下。三向字符串快速排序可以很好的解决这个问题,其是MSD和快速排序的结合版。三向字符串快排有两个标记,第一个标记lt指向字符串集合开始位置,第二个标记gt指向字符串...

2016-03-05 20:57:09

阅读数 1312

评论数 0

OJ的输入输出问题

OJ的输入输出问题标签: 博客 工具1.引言以前接触的OJ都是直接编写一个成员函数,不需要考虑读入数据的问题。今天做了某公司2016年研发工程师的编程题,题倒是不难,但是需要考虑读入数据的问题,然后就跪在了这里……好久没接触数据的输入问题,查阅了一些资料,总结一下,以免以后再跪在这里,太委屈了。主...

2016-03-03 13:58:53

阅读数 2099

评论数 0

小白学算法3.2——高位优先字符串排序

小白学算法3.2——高位优先字符串排序标签: 小白学算法 博客本节内容总结自《算法(第4版)》5.1节1.高位优先字符串排序字符串常见的排序算法有两种,分别是低位优先(LSD)和高位优先(MSD),低位优先从右向左检查字符,高位优先从左向右检查字符。低位优先字符串排序要求待排序的字符串长度一致,然...

2016-03-02 17:27:11

阅读数 2267

评论数 0

小白学算法3.1——低位优先字符串排序

小白学算法3.1——低位优先字符串排序标签: 小白学算法 博客本节内容总结自《算法(第4版)》5.1节1.低位优先字符串排序相比较于数字,字符串在生活中出现的频率更高,更常用,如姓名、车牌和电话号码等,而字符串常常也需要按照一定的顺序存放(一般是ASCII顺序),此时决定顺序的键就是字符串。字符串...

2016-02-22 10:36:25

阅读数 1952

评论数 0

条形码识别(4)——校验

条形码识别(4)——校验标签: 机器视觉 条形码识别 Python1.目标EAN13条形码一共有13位,最后1位是校验位,该位是通过前12位按照一定的步骤计算出来的。如果按照一定的步骤处理识别出的前12位数据,如果计算结果和识别出的结果相等,识别正确;如果不相等,则重新识别或纠错再校验或提示识别失...

2016-01-29 15:48:57

阅读数 2391

评论数 4

提示
确定要删除当前文章?
取消 删除
关闭
关闭